1/2x +1/3 y = 3

Which of the following equations is equivalent to the given equation?

3x + 2y = 3
2x + 3y = 18
3x + 2y = 18

C is the correct answer.
If you want to check it just divide both sides by six.
3/6x + 2/6y = 18/6
1/2 + 1/3y = 3
